A teenager is campaigning to save a bus service that provides the only means she has to see her boyfriend.

Catherine Walker also says the X59 bus between Skipton and Harrogate is essential if she is to complete her gold Duke of Edinburgh Award.

The 17-year-old Sutton-in-Craven resident is angry the service is to be reduced next month after a council subsidy was taken away.

She has spoken with fellow passengers and urged them to write letters of protest to save the X59. She has also launched a petition against the cutbacks.

The Craven College sports student said: “My boyfriend lives in Harrogate and we use the bus to see one another.

“I also use the X59 every week to get to the Scout group where I am still working on my Duke of Edinburgh Award.

“I can’t afford the alternative, which is to catch two trains,.”
